q. In Pre-Operative Area, introduces self to patient, verifies patient identity, assesses patient’s physical needs, alleviates patient anxiety, clarifies operative site, and checks chart for necessary documentation.
r. Practices and monitors aseptic techniques.
s. Ensures that the surgical site time-out process is followed and completed.
t. Performs duties as circulating or scrub nurse.
u. Is responsible for positioning patient relevant to procedure with awareness of body alignment, circulation and pressure points.
v. Applies electrosurgical return electrodes, tourniquets, etc., according to physician preference, policies and procedures.
w. Provides necessary supportive equipment for patient comfort (i.e., pillows, blankets, protective paddings, etc…).
x. Accurately completes intraoperative record.
y. Is accountable for accuracy and documentation of sponge, needle and instrument counts.
z. Properly labels and cares for specimens.
aa. Provides and records all intraoperative medications.
bb. Maintains adequate room supplies.
cc. Is knowledgeable of operation, cleaning and sterilization of instruments.

Requirements:Education, Experience, and Licensure:
Graduate of an Accredited School of Nursing. At least one year of Operating Room Circulator experience is preferred. Current state licensure to practice. Successful completion of Basic Life Support (BLS) /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) within 90 days of employment or documentation of current BLS/ACLS certification. Successful completion of ACLS Course within 90 days of employment or documentation of current ACLS certification, Successful completion of PALS Course within 90 days of employment or documentation of current PALS certification, if requested by supervisor. Specialty certification in Perioperative Nursing
